diff --git a/src/include/cbfs.h b/src/include/cbfs.h index c1c1e33743..148317702a 100644 --- a/src/include/cbfs.h +++ b/src/include/cbfs.h @@ -49,130 +49,13 @@ #ifndef _CBFS_H_ #define _CBFS_H_ +#include "cbfs_core.h" #include <boot/coreboot_tables.h> -/** These are standard values for the known compression - alogrithms that coreboot knows about for stages and - payloads. Of course, other CBFS users can use whatever - values they want, as long as they understand them. */ -#define CBFS_COMPRESS_NONE 0 -#define CBFS_COMPRESS_LZMA 1 - -/** These are standard component types for well known - components (i.e - those that coreboot needs to consume. - Users are welcome to use any other value for their - components */ - -#define CBFS_TYPE_STAGE 0x10 -#define CBFS_TYPE_PAYLOAD 0x20 -#define CBFS_TYPE_OPTIONROM 0x30 -#define CBFS_TYPE_BOOTSPLASH 0x40 -#define CBFS_TYPE_RAW 0x50 -#define CBFS_TYPE_VSA 0x51 -#define CBFS_TYPE_MBI 0x52 -#define CBFS_TYPE_MICROCODE 0x53 -#define CBFS_COMPONENT_CMOS_DEFAULT 0xaa -#define CBFS_COMPONENT_CMOS_LAYOUT 0x01aa - - -/** this is the master cbfs header - it need to be - located somewhere in the bootblock. Where it - actually lives is up to coreboot. A pointer to - this header will live at 0xFFFFFFFc, so we can - easily find it. */ - -#define CBFS_HEADER_MAGIC 0x4F524243 -#define CBFS_HEADPTR_ADDR 0xFFFFFFFc -#define VERSION1 0x31313131 - -struct cbfs_header { - u32 magic; - u32 version; - u32 romsize; - u32 bootblocksize; - u32 align; - u32 offset; - u32 pad[2]; -} __attribute__((packed)); - -/** This is a component header - every entry in the CBFS - will have this header. - - This is how the component is arranged in the ROM: - - -------------- <- 0 - component header - -------------- <- sizeof(struct component) - component name - -------------- <- offset - data - ... - -------------- <- offset + len -*/ - -#define CBFS_FILE_MAGIC "LARCHIVE" - -struct cbfs_file { - char magic[8]; - u32 len; - u32 type; - u32 checksum; - u32 offset; -} __attribute__((packed)); - -/*** Component sub-headers ***/ - -/* Following are component sub-headers for the "standard" - component types */ - -/** This is the sub-header for stage components. Stages are - loaded by coreboot during the normal boot process */ - -struct cbfs_stage { - u32 compression; /** Compression type */ - u64 entry; /** entry point */ - u64 load; /** Where to load in memory */ - u32 len; /** length of data to load */ - u32 memlen; /** total length of object in memory */ -} __attribute__((packed)); - -/** this is the sub-header for payload components. Payloads - are loaded by coreboot at the end of the boot process */ - -struct cbfs_payload_segment { - u32 type; - u32 compression; - u32 offset; - u64 load_addr; - u32 len; - u32 mem_len; -} __attribute__((packed)); - -struct cbfs_payload { - struct cbfs_payload_segment segments; -}; - -#define PAYLOAD_SEGMENT_CODE 0x45444F43 -#define PAYLOAD_SEGMENT_DATA 0x41544144 -#define PAYLOAD_SEGMENT_BSS 0x20535342 -#define PAYLOAD_SEGMENT_PARAMS 0x41524150 -#define PAYLOAD_SEGMENT_ENTRY 0x52544E45 - -struct cbfs_optionrom { - u32 compression; - u32 len; -} __attribute__((packed)); - -#define CBFS_NAME(_c) (((char *) (_c)) + sizeof(struct cbfs_file)) -#define CBFS_SUBHEADER(_p) ( (void *) ((((u8 *) (_p)) + ntohl((_p)->offset))) ) - -void * cbfs_load_payload(struct lb_memory *lb_mem, const char *name); -void * cbfs_load_stage(const char *name); +void *cbfs_load_payload(struct lb_memory *lb_mem, const char *name); +void *cbfs_load_stage(const char *name); int cbfs_execute_stage(const char *name); -void * cbfs_get_file(const char *name); void *cbfs_load_optionrom(u16 vendor, u16 device, void * dest); int run_address(void *f); -struct cbfs_file *cbfs_find(const char *name); -void *cbfs_find_file(const char *name, int type); #endif |
